CSS3 Media Queries
• The CSS3 Media Queries Module specifies methods to enable web developers to scope a style sheet to a set of precise device capabilities.
![Page 21: Prairie Dev Con West - 2012-03-15 - Responsive Web Design](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022060108/554d1ef6b4c905ca208b4a0b/html5/thumbnails/21.jpg)
Simple Example
@media screen and (max-width: 600px) {
body {
font-size: 80%;
}
}
![Page 22: Prairie Dev Con West - 2012-03-15 - Responsive Web Design](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022060108/554d1ef6b4c905ca208b4a0b/html5/thumbnails/22.jpg)
Other Queries
@media screen and (min-width:320px) and (max-width:480px)
@media not print and (max-width:600px)
@media screen (x) and (y), print (a) and (b)
![Page 23: Prairie Dev Con West - 2012-03-15 - Responsive Web Design](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022060108/554d1ef6b4c905ca208b4a0b/html5/thumbnails/23.jpg)
Can be declared… In the Stylesheet
Import Rule
@import url(mq.css) only screen and (max-width:600px)
link Element
<link rel=“stylesheet” media=“only screen and (max-width:800px)” href=“mq.css”>
![Page 24: Prairie Dev Con West - 2012-03-15 - Responsive Web Design](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022060108/554d1ef6b4c905ca208b4a0b/html5/thumbnails/24.jpg)
Supported Media Properties
• min/max-width
• min/max-height
• device-width
• device-height
• orientation
• aspect-ratio
• device-aspect-ratio
• color
• color-index
• monochrome
• resolution

What About Devices?
• viewport meta tag
• <meta name=“viewport” content=“width=device-width”>
• device-width vs. width
• maximum-zoom
![Page 27: Prairie Dev Con West - 2012-03-15 - Responsive Web Design](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022060108/554d1ef6b4c905ca208b4a0b/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
What about non-supportive browsers?
• css3-mediaqueries-js by Wouter van der Graaf
• Just include the script in your pages
• Parses the CSS and applies style for positive media tests
